Why did Qing Dynasty palace maids have to sleep on their sides with their legs curled up?

In addition to serving the concubines in the harem, ancient palace maids had many rules to follow, including strict regulations on sleeping positions. In the books “Thanh Su Cao” and “Song Su” there are related records, saying that palace ladies must squeeze both legs tightly when sleeping, not spreading their legs wide. If caught violating by the palace maids, they will be dragged out and beaten or decapitated.

Regarding the rules that palace maids need to follow, in a book called “Memoirs of Palace Maids” by Forbidden City Publishing House, published in the last century, palace maid Ha Vinh Nhi, who served Cixi Thai after 8 years, described their lives in great detail. For example, when new maids enter the palace, they must call all the senior maids of the previous generation “aunt”. The new maids not only served their masters but also had to attend to the “aunt’s” daily life, including washing her face, combing her hair, washing her feet, and bathing.

Young palace maids often work from early morning until late at night, only being able to rest after being exhausted. But in the middle of the night, they were often inspected by the palace maid and stood up to scold them. They woke up, eyes dreamy, not knowing what had happened. After a while, they understood that they had violated the rules about sleeping positions.

Although sleeping posture is important in the palace, it only applies to the palace ladies. No matter how the emperor and his concubines slept, no one dared to interfere.

The book “Memoirs of a Palace Lady” describes in great detail: “Lie on your side, legs bent, one arm next to your body, one arm straight out.” In short, the standard sleeping position of royal ladies is: lying on the side, right leg slightly bent, legs stacked on top of each other, and using one hand as a pillow.

Why impose strict requirements on sleeping positions for palace maids? The first reason is due to belief. Feudal society worshiped gods and in the palaces where the emperor lived, there would be gods protecting everywhere. In the evening, the gods in the palaces would come down to check, and if the sleeping position of the maids was not according to regulations, the gods would feel disrespected and could punish them, affecting the emperor. and national destiny.

The second reason is to show social hierarchy. Feudal society had a strict hierarchical system and very specific regulations on materials and patterns for the costumes of mandarins at all levels. For example, the highest-ranking mandarins wear the Tien Hac palace uniform, the second-class mandarins wear the Golden Rooster palace uniform… The purpose of this is to always remind people of their position and to be careful. In words and actions, do not cross the boundary. In the palace, the emperor and his concubines could sleep any way they wanted, but the maids were only allowed to lie on their sides, which always reminded them: I can’t even sleep like master, because I is a slave.

The third reason is the space issue. Although the ancient palace was very large, most of the space was reserved for the emperor and his concubines. That is, the bedrooms of thousands of palace maids are very small simply because they have low status. The ruler believes that if they let them sleep comfortably in large rooms and big beds, they will forget who they are. Therefore, the palace maids could only be arranged to sleep in a common bed, so that they would not forget their identity. On a shared bed, the space is very narrow, you can’t lie horizontally, so you can only lie on your side to save space.
